1. A computer-implemented method, comprising:
receiving, at an agent service manager, a control request from an agent controller that manages collection agents that collect data, wherein the agent controller and the collection agents operate on a remote computing machine, the control request including a class level indicating a class of collection agents that collect data;
identifying a desired agent event to be executed in association with a set of collection agents of the collection agents managed by the agent controller, the desired agent event comprising an upgrade event, a downgrade event, or a certificate event to be executed in association with the set of collection agents, wherein the desired agent event to be executed is identified based on the class level indicated in the control request; and
providing an indication of the desired agent event to the agent controller for execution of the desired agent event in association with each collection agent of the set of collection agents.
